Cyclomedia captures street-level and aerial imagery using proprietary mobile mapping vehicles equipped with cameras, LiDAR scanners, and precision positioning systems. The raw data—collected at petabyte scale annually—is processed into 3D visualizations, panoramic imagery, and machine-learning-derived insights sold primarily to city governments, infrastructure operators, and utilities across North America and Western Europe. The company operates from three regional hubs (Netherlands, Wisconsin, Germany) and serves customers whose primary need is accurate, current environmental data to inform capital planning, asset management, and public-safety decisions. Distribution channels mix direct sales and specialist GIS channels (Esri ecosystem).
Cyclomedia's stack centers on Esri geospatial tools (ArcGIS Pro, ArcGIS Online, ArcGIS Portal, ArcGIS), QGIS, and cloud infrastructure on Azure. LiDAR and GIS form the analytical core; FME handles data transformation. CRM/sales ops run on HubSpot, Salesforce, and Dynamics 365.
Cyclomedia specializes in mobile mapping, photogrammetry, LiDAR capture, and AI-powered content analysis. Core offerings include 360° street-level panoramic imagery, 3D reconstruction, and GIS-integrated analytics targeting smart-city and utility-sector decision-making.
